Does Anxiety Cause Headaches? Understanding the Connection, Symptoms, and Solutions

Date02/02/2026

Quick Answer: Yes, anxiety can cause headaches. Anxiety triggers the body’s fight-or-flight response, increases muscle tension, and heightens pain sensitivity, often leading to tension headaches or migraines. Recognizing stress, poor sleep, and lifestyle factors as triggers can help prevent and manage anxiety-induced headaches effectively.

If you have ever experienced a tight, throbbing pain in your head during stressful situations, you may be wondering: does anxiety cause headaches? The short answer is yes. Anxiety can indeed trigger headaches by increasing muscle tension, activating the nervous system, and making your body more sensitive to pain.

Headaches caused by anxiety are very common, but they are often overlooked or misdiagnosed. Many people struggle with repeated headaches and fail to link them to underlying anxiety. Understanding this connection is essential because it allows you to take proactive steps to reduce headaches naturally and improve overall wellbeing. 

Understanding Anxiety and Its Physical Effects

What Is Anxiety?

Anxiety is a natural emotional response that occurs when the brain perceives a threat, danger, or high-pressure situation. While everyone experiences occasional worry, chronic anxiety can affect both the mind and body. Anxiety causes racing thoughts, feelings of restlessness, irritability, and difficulty concentrating. Physically, it manifests as rapid heartbeat, shallow breathing, sweating, digestive disturbances, and increased muscle tension.

By understanding what anxiety is, we can see how it directly influences the development of headaches. Many people ask: does anxiety cause headaches, and the answer is yes, because the physical symptoms of anxiety put stress on the muscles and nerves connected to the head and neck. In many cases, anxiety-related symptoms overlap with other physical concerns, such as can anxiety cause chest pain highlighting how stress impacts the body beyond just the head.

The Science of Anxiety’s Physical Symptoms

Anxiety triggers the body’s fight-or-flight response, a survival mechanism designed to prepare the body for immediate danger. During this response, stress hormones such as adrenaline and cortisol are released. These hormones increase heart rate, elevate blood pressure, and tighten muscles.

Muscle tension, particularly in the neck, shoulders, and scalp, contributes significantly to headache pain. At the same time, the nervous system becomes highly alert, which increases sensitivity to pain. This is why many individuals experience tension headaches or migraines during periods of high anxiety. If you have been asking yourself, does anxiety cause headaches, the answer lies in this intricate connection between mind, body, and stress response.

Can Anxiety Cause Headaches?

Anxiety can lead to headaches in multiple ways. Understanding these mechanisms is essential for effective prevention and management. Anxiety can cause headaches through:

  • Persistent muscle tension in the neck, shoulders, and scalp, creating pressure that manifests as headache pain
  • Activation of the nervous system, which keeps the body in a heightened state of alertness, making it more prone to headaches
  • Increased sensitivity to pain, meaning that even minor discomfort can feel more intense during anxious periods

Types of Headaches Linked to Anxiety

There are several headache types commonly linked to anxiety. Knowing the difference can help you identify whether your headaches are anxiety-induced:

  • Tension headaches usually present as dull, constant pressure around the forehead, temples, or back of the head. They are often triggered by stress, poor posture, or long periods of mental strain.
  • Migraines are more intense, often one-sided, and may include symptoms such as nausea, light sensitivity, and pulsating pain. Anxiety can act as a trigger for migraines, making them more frequent or severe.

An important point to remember is the bidirectional relationship between anxiety and headaches. Anxiety can cause headaches, and frequent headaches or chronic pain can increase stress and anxiety, creating a self-perpetuating cycle. This explains why the question does anxiety cause headaches arises so frequently. It also connects with related concerns like does anxiety cause dizziness as both symptoms stem from nervous system activation.

Symptoms of Anxiety-Induced Headaches

Identifying anxiety-related headaches requires paying attention to both the physical and emotional symptoms of anxiety.

Common Signs

If your headaches are related to anxiety, you may notice:

  • Dull, persistent pain across the forehead or temples
  • Tightness or stiffness in the neck, shoulders, or scalp
  • A feeling of pressure or a “band-like” sensation around your head
  • Fatigue, irritability, or difficulty concentrating during or after the headache

How to Distinguish From Other Headaches

Not all headaches are caused by anxiety. Here are ways to differentiate anxiety-induced headaches from other common headache types:

  • Sinus headaches are usually accompanied by nasal congestion, facial pressure, or a runny nose
  • Migraines typically involve intense, pulsating pain on one side of the head, often with nausea or sensitivity to light and sound
  • Cluster headaches cause severe stabbing pain, often behind one eye, with additional tearing or redness

If your headaches consistently occur during stressful situations or anxiety episodes, it is likely that anxiety is the primary trigger. This further supports the question, does anxiety cause headaches, with a strong affirmative answer.

Common Triggers That Link Anxiety and Headaches

Anxiety alone may not cause headaches unless combined with certain triggers. Understanding these triggers can help you prevent headaches before they start.

Stress and Emotional Triggers

  • Work deadlines, professional pressures, or academic stress
  • Relationship challenges, family responsibilities, or personal life stressors
  • Major life events, such as moving, financial strain, or health concerns

Sleep, Diet, and Lifestyle Factors

  • Poor or irregular sleep patterns
  • Skipping meals, eating processed foods, or lacking essential nutrients
  • Dehydration or excessive caffeine consumption

Daily Habits That Worsen Headaches and Anxiety

  • Spending long hours on screens without breaks
  • Clenching your jaw or grinding your teeth
  • Sitting in poor posture for extended periods

By addressing these triggers, you can significantly reduce the frequency and intensity of anxiety-induced headaches.

How to Prevent and Manage Anxiety-Related Headaches

Preventing anxiety headaches requires a combination of stress management, lifestyle adjustments, and mindful practices.

Stress Reduction Techniques

  • Practice deep breathing exercises such as box breathing or the 4-7-8 method
  • Engage in meditation or mindfulness practices to calm the mind
  • Use progressive muscle relaxation to release tension in the neck, shoulders, and head

Lifestyle Adjustments

  • Maintain consistent sleep routines and create a sleep-friendly environment
  • Incorporate regular physical activity, stretching, and yoga to release tension
  • Eat a balanced diet and stay hydrated to support overall physical health

In addition, supporting muscle recovery and overall physical resilience through proper nutrition can be helpful. Options such as protein with creatine may support muscle repair and reduce tension when combined with regular exercise and hydration.

When to Seek Professional Support

Seek professional help if:

  • Headaches are frequent, intense, or interfere with daily life
  • Anxiety symptoms are persistent and affecting your mental health
  • You want personalized guidance combining functional nutrition, stress management, and holistic wellness strategies

The Science of Good Health offers tools, programs, and guidance for managing anxiety and its physical effects, including headaches, through functional nutrition and holistic lifestyle support.

How The Science of Good Health Helps You Feel Better

The Science of Good Health focuses on providing holistic solutions for reducing anxiety and preventing headaches. Our approach includes:

  • Functional nutrition plans designed to support both brain and body health
  • Natural anti-anxiety supplements to reduce stress and improve mood
  • Wellness programs that integrate mindfulness, movement, and lifestyle adjustments

By addressing the root causes of stress and anxiety, you can reduce headaches and improve your overall sense of wellbeing.

Conclusion

So, does anxiety cause headaches? The answer is yes. Anxiety can lead to tension headaches, increase sensitivity to pain, and trigger migraines in susceptible individuals. These headaches can be persistent and disruptive, but with the right lifestyle habits, stress management techniques, and holistic support, they are often manageable. By understanding the connection between anxiety and headaches, you can take proactive steps to prevent them and improve your quality of life.

Read Our Latest Blogs:

Monk Fruit Sweetener Vs Stevia | Best Monk Fruit Sweetener | Monk Fruit Sweetener Benefits | How To Prepare Aloe Vera Juice | When To Drink Aloe Vera Juice | Which Aloe Vera Juice Is Best | How Much Protein In 100 Gm Paneer | How Much Protein In 100 Gm Chicken | How Much Protein In 1 Glass Milk | Which Protein Powder Is Best For Weight Gain For Female | Can Protein Powder Cause Constipation | Can Protein Powder Cause Hair Loss | Which Is The Best Protein Powder In India

 

Frequently Asked Questions

Q1. Can mild anxiety cause headaches?

Yes, even mild anxiety can cause headaches. Muscle tension and heightened nervous system activity during anxiety can trigger mild to moderate head pain.

Q2. How long do anxiety-induced headaches last?

These headaches can last from 30 minutes to several hours, depending on the severity of stress and the individual’s response to anxiety.

Q3. Are anxiety headaches the same as migraines?

No, anxiety headaches are usually dull and tension-related, while migraines are intense, one-sided, and may include nausea or sensitivity to light and sound.

Q4. Can improving sleep reduce anxiety headaches?

Absolutely. Poor sleep increases stress levels and muscle tension, making headaches more likely. A consistent sleep schedule and quality rest help prevent headaches.

Q5. Does dehydration make anxiety headaches worse?

Yes, dehydration can worsen both anxiety and headache symptoms. Drinking adequate water throughout the day is essential for prevention.

Q6. Can exercise help prevent anxiety headaches?

Yes, regular physical activity reduces stress, improves circulation, and eases muscle tension, all of which help prevent anxiety-induced headaches.

Q7. Are anxiety headaches dangerous?

Generally, anxiety headaches are not dangerous but can affect daily life if chronic. Seek professional help if headaches are severe, persistent, or interfere with normal functioning.

Q8. What holistic strategies work best for anxiety headaches?

Meditation, functional nutrition, stress reduction exercises, proper sleep, hydration, and mindful posture practices are effective in managing and preventing anxiety-induced headaches.